Side-by-Side Comparison

Feature déchargement déchirement
Definition Action de décharger un navire, un bateau, une voiture de transport, une bête de somme, etc. Action de déchirer, d’être déchiré ou résultat de cette action.

Look-alike desk: déchargement vs déchirement

A purely visual mix-up. déchargement (\de.ʃaʁ.ʒə.mɑ̃\) and déchirement (\de.ʃiʁ.mɑ̃\) are said differently, so reading them aloud is the quickest way to catch the wrong one. On the page they stay close: they differ by 1 letter(s) in length. Our composite confusion score for this pair is 74374, derived from the frequency rank of both members and their visual similarity.

déchargement is recorded at frequency rank #33,650, classified as anoun, pronounced \de.ʃaʁ.ʒə.mɑ̃\. déchirement is at rank #40,724, tagged as anoun, pronounced \de.ʃiʁ.mɑ̃\.
